FAST series prepares to
heat up the winter with 2nd Annual Racers' Chilli Challenge
By Bryan Autullo -
FAST Public Relations
(Maumee, OH) Plans are underway
for the "2nd Annual Racer’s Chili Challenge"
and race teams and fans
should mark Saturday, February 20th on their
calendars. This year's event
will be held in Fremont, Ohio once again, but
this time at the Ballville
Township Community Hall located at 1413 East Cole
Road (across from the fire
station). The Kistler Racing Products Fremont/
Attica Sprint Title (F.A.S.T.)
organization will once again be heading up
the planning of the chili
cook-off along with the help of the Hoserville
Ohio gang and several other
generous volunteers. This event was established
to bring fans, teams, promoters
& drivers together in the off-season for
some good fun, great chili,
and a little bit of bench racing before the
green flags wave once again
at Attica Raceway Park and Fremont Speedway in
2010.
The doors will open to the
public at 1 p.m. and general admission is just
$5.00 at the door. Children
12 & under will be admitted free with a paid
adult. Admission includes
a sample cup and spoon to taste each team’s chili
creation. Be sure to visit
your favorite team’s booth often and vote for
them as "The People's Choice"
award.
"The Inaugural Racer's Chili
Challenge was a big success,” says F.A.S.T.
co-founder Bryan Autullo.
"There were about 22 entries last year in 4
different categories and
a lot of really great chili was consumed by the
large crowd that showed
up on a cold and snowy winter day." Last winter's
celebrity judges (Brad Doty,
Kenny Jacobs, Jim Linder, and Darl Harrison)
voted the WFIN radio "Racing
World" team as the "Grand Champion" and fans
came from as far away as
Western Pennsylvania to sample the chili, mingle
with the Fremont & Attica
drivers and the local racing legends throughout
the afternoon. "We're sticking
to pretty much the same formula for 2010,"
Autullo added. "We're going
to do a few things differently, but for the most
part it will be the same
recipe for a good time that we cooked up in 2009.
We’ll have celebrity judges,
games for the kids, a driver autograph session,
and a couple of show cars
this February."
Celebrity judges will once
again determine the best chili in each of the
three divisions (Sprint
Cars, Late Models/ Dirt Trucks & Fans/Media) and the
winning team will receive
a chili pot trophy and prize packs from Fremont
Speedway, Attica Raceway
Park, the F.A.S.T Series, and Hoserville Ohio. “The
People's Choice" chili will
be voted on by the general public and the winner
will receive the Grand Champion
chili pot trophy and their choice of either
a $100 gift certificate
to Kistler Racing Products or $100 cash.
Scott Porter, co-founder
of the F.A.S.T. organization commented, "We're also
bringing back the KS Sales
& Service Hot Head Jalapeño Eating Contest and
thanks to Kevin Shammo we're
doubling the prize money to $100 for the
winner. This event was the
highlight last year as Jason Tomczyk consumed 15
peppers in five minutes,
while the event left several other contestants in
tears." Another event
returning is the Rock-Paper-Scissors Tournament for
the kids (17 & under)
presented by Computer Man, Inc. of Fremont, Ohio. New
in 2010 will be a beanbag
tournament presented by Hoserville Ohio - a
charity organization that
helps injured drivers with their medical expenses.
Registration for the tournaments
will take place the day of the event.
